Safety Screening 5 Calf Implants Red Flags in Boston
These warning indicators appear in practices that fail our independent vetting standard. Identify them before committing to a consultation.
Only surgeons board-certified by the American Board of Plastic Surgery (ABPS) are indexed in our Boston registry. Cosmetic surgery certifications from unrecognized boards do not meet this standard.
Operating suites must carry AAAHC or JCAHO accreditation. Non-accredited facilities bypass safety inspection requirements, increasing your risk exposure.
Multi-hour procedures such as this one require a physician-level anesthesiologist — not a CRNA operating alone. Confirm credentials before signing consent forms.
Elite board-certified surgeons provide transparent revision policies in writing prior to surgery. Vague verbal commitments are a reliable predictor of post-op financial disputes.
A proper consultation for this procedure must be conducted by the operating surgeon — not a patient coordinator. Consultations under 30 minutes are a strong disqualifying signal.
